A support wire to the top of a newly planted tree is 15 m long. It forms an angle of 30° to the ground. On the same side of the tree, a second wire is also attached to the top of the tree, but it makes an angle of 45° to the ground. Determine an exact expression for the distance between the points where the two support wires are attached to the ground.
